Technical Analysis

CVE-2026-8053 is an out-of-bounds write vulnerability (CWE-787) in MongoDB Server's time-series collection feature. An authenticated user with write privileges can exploit an inconsistency in the internal mapping of field names to indexes within the time-series bucket catalog, causing memory corruption in the mongod process. This memory corruption can potentially lead to arbitrary code execution. The vulnerability affects MongoDB Server versions 5.0 prior to 5.0.33, 6.0 prior to 6.0.28, 7.0 prior to 7.0.34, 8.0 prior to 8.0.23, 8.2 prior to 8.2.9, and 8.3 prior to 8.3.2. The CVSS 4.0 base score is 8.7, indicating high severity with network attack vector, low attack complexity, no user interaction, and high imp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ability. No patch or official remediation level is provided in the source data, and no known exploits have been reported.

Potential Impact

The vulnerability allows an authenticated user with database write privileges to trigger an out-of-bounds memory write in the mongod process, which can lead to arbitrary code execution. This compromises the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of the MongoDB Server. The impact is high due to the potential for remote code execution without user interaction and low attack complexity.

Mitigation Recommendations

Patch status is not yet confirmed — check the MongoDB vendor advisory for current remediation guidance. Since no official patch or remediation level is provided in the available data, users should monitor MongoDB's security advisories and apply updates to versions 5.0.33, 6.0.28, 7.0.34, 8.0.23, 8.2.9, or 8.3.2 and later once confirmed. Until patched, restrict database write privileges to trusted users only to reduce risk.
